How they compare

Pakistan currently reports 45.4% against 41.1% in Senegal, a difference of 4.3%.

That makes Pakistan's figure about 1.1 times Senegal's.

Across all 25 years both countries report, Pakistan has been ahead every year.

Pakistan ranks 84th and Senegal ranks 86th of 105 countries.

Pakistan has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Pakistan Senegal Difference Ahead
2000s 45.1% 39.4% 5.7% Pakistan
2010s 45.3% 40.3% 5.0% Pakistan
2020s 45.4% 40.9% 4.5% Pakistan

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
